Royal History and Cultural Significance

If you have imagined entering a realm of royal rulers, storytelling palaces, and living traditions on every corner, then exploring Jaipur is perfect for you.

Known as the Pink City, Jaipur isn’t just another tourist destination—it’s an experience wrapped in history, color, and culture.

Established in 1727 by Maharaja Sawai Jai Singh II, the city showcases a mix of Rajput elegance and planned design.

Each street in Jaipur resembles a chapter from history.

From traditional attire to folk music echoing in the air, the city thrives on its deep-rooted heritage.

While touring Jaipur, you don’t simply see monuments—you experience traditions that continue to influence daily life.

The warmth of locals, the intricate handicrafts, and the vibrant festivals like Teej and Gangaur make Jaipur a cultural powerhouse that draws millions every year.

The Charm of Jaipur’s Architecture and Pink Aesthetic

One of Jaipur’s most captivating features is its architectural beauty.

Imagine entire streets painted in terracotta pink, reflecting the hospitality and royal welcome extended to visitors since the 19th century.

The city's layout follows Vastu Shastra principles, making it one of the earliest planned cities in India.

The architectural brilliance lies in its details—ornate balconies, delicate latticework, and massive gateways that transport you to a different era.

Whether it’s forts perched on hills or palaces nestled in the heart of the city, Jaipur's skyline is nothing short of magical.

Exploring Jaipur is like strolling through a living museum filled with stories.

Amber Fort – A Grand Hilltop Wonder

No Jaipur sightseeing tour is complete without visiting Amber Fort.

Just outside Jaipur, this stunning fort rises above Maota Lake on a hill.

Inside, the fort is a masterpiece of artistry.

The Sheesh Mahal amazes visitors with countless mirrors creating stunning reflections.

Walking through the courtyards and halls, you can almost imagine royal gatherings and celebrations that once took place here.

This is not just a fort but a reflection of Rajasthan’s regal heritage.

City Palace – Royal Residence of Jaipur

Located centrally, the City Palace remains the residence of Jaipur’s royal family.

This complex merges Mughal and Rajput architecture with elegant detailing and large courtyards.

The museum exhibits costumes, arms, and artifacts that highlight royal traditions.

What makes this place special is its authenticity—it’s not just preserved history, it’s still alive.

Hawa Mahal – The Iconic Palace of Winds

Seeing Hawa Mahal explains its popularity among photographers.

The five-level building with honeycomb windows allowed royal women to watch events unseen.

Though it looks fragile, it efficiently keeps interiors cool.

It shows a balance between aesthetics and function.

Visiting Hawa Mahal during sunrise offers a breathtaking view you won’t forget.

Jantar Mantar – A Scientific Wonder

A UNESCO World Heritage Site, Jantar Mantar Jaipur is unlike anything you’ve seen before.

Built by Maharaja Jai Singh II, this astronomical observatory features massive instruments used to measure time, track celestial bodies, and predict eclipses.

Even if you’re not a science enthusiast, the sheer scale and precision of these instruments are awe-inspiring.

It highlights historical scientific progress in India.
